[On computability-theoretic aspects of Stone spaces]
Н. А. Баженов |
|
Аннотация:
The roots of computable analysis go back to the seminal work of Turing (1936). One of the main directions in contemporary computable analysis studies computability aspects of Polish spaces. A computable Polish space is a Polish space equipped with a distinguished dense countable sequence of points such that the distances between these points are uniformly computable.
In the talk, we focus on Stone spaces. Recall that a Stone space is a compact and totally disconnected Hausdorff space. The classical result of Stone established a duality between the category of Stone spaces and the category of Boolean algebras. We give an overview of some recent results on the computability-theoretic properties of separable Stone spaces. In particular, we discuss effective versions of the Stone duality.
